I'm new here, so I hope I explain this right. I have an ASUS TUF Gaming A15, and I'm having a problem where it doesn't always turn on when I press the power button—maybe there's a gap between the button and the hardware, but that's not my main concern right now. I'm looking for advice on how to move it between houses (a quick 5-minute drive) without it shutting off. Additionally, I'd like to know how much it typically costs to have it checked out or repaired in Illinois. Thanks for your help!

If you want to move it with the lid closed, you can adjust the settings so that the lid does nothing when closed. Just remember, contacting local repair shops for estimates is your best bet regarding repair costs.
To keep your laptop running while transporting it, go into your power settings and disable any sleep or standby timers. Just be sure to keep the lid open while moving it to your new place. If the battery doesn't hold up well, then consider using a portable charger.

Generally, it's not a great idea to keep a powered-on laptop during transport. It could overheat due to ventilation issues, and if you have a spinning HDD, it might get damaged from the movement, even in a short trip.
